Title :
Software requirements specification database based on requirements frame model

Abstract :
The author proposes a method to build a relational database of software requirements specifications (SRSs) from textual SRSs automatically. The author has been developing a requirements model called requirements frame and a text-base requirements language based on the model in order to improve the quality of SRSs. Since requirements frame can be transformed into a relational data model, each of the requirement sentences can be regarded as a tuple of a relational table. The author has been developing both a query language and a relational database management system for on SRS database. One of the features of the SRS DB system is to give an answer with a requirement sentence as an example/counter-example. This feature contributes to verification of the SRS from a developer´s own viewpoint. Another feature is detecting changed requirements in modification of the SRS. This feature contributes to effective maintenance of the SRS
